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ken thighs
- 1 cup apple cider
- 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on fresh thyme, chopped
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
For the slaw:
- 2 cups green cabbage, shredded
- 1 cup red cabbage, shredded
- 1 cup carrots, shredded
- 1/4 cup green onions, sliced
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 3 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on honey
- Salt and pepper to taste
Prep Time, Cook Time, Total Time, Yield
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
Directions and Instructions
- In a mixing bowl, combine the apple cider, apple cider vinegar, honey, minced garlic, chopped thyme, and a sprinkle of salt and pepper. Whisk until fully blended to create a delectable marinade.
- Place the chicken thighs in a resealable bag or a shallow dish and pour the marinade over them. Seal it well and allow it to marinate in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our, or ideally overnight for optimum flavor.
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C), filling your kitchen with a cozy aroma.
- Heat the ol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the marinated chicken thighs, searing them for about 2-3 minutes on each side until they are beautifully golden brown.
- Transfer the seared chicken to a baking dish and pour the remaining marinade over the top.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is thoroughly cooked and re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C).
- While the chicken bakes, prepare the slaw by tossing together the shredded green and red cabbages, shredded carrots, green onions, and fresh parsley in a large bowl.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the apple cider vinegar, olive oil, honey, and a dash of salt and pepper. Drizzle this zesty dressing over the slaw and toss well to ensure everything is nicely coated.
- Serve the chicken hot from the oven, gleaming with a sticky glaze, alongside the crisp autumn slaw for a meal that’s both satisfying and refreshing.
Notes or Tips
- For an extra flavor boost, consider adding a pinch of cinnamon to the marinade or slaw dressing.
- If you have leftovers, the chicken makes a fantastic addition to salads or wraps the next day!
- Feel free to mix up the types of cabbage or add in other crunchy veggies you love!
Cooking Techniques
This recipe features marinating and searing techniques that enhance the chicken’s flavor and maintain its juiciness. Marinating not only infuses the chicken with rich, tangy notes, but it also tenderizes the meat. Searing creates a delicious golden crust while locking in moisture, leading to the perfect balance of textures when baked.
FAQ
- Can I use bone-in chicken thighs? Yes, bone-in thighs will work well! Just adjust your cooking time, as they may need a few extra minutes to reach the desired temperature.
- What can I serve with this dish? Beyond the crisp slaw, this dish pairs beautifully with mashed potatoes, roasted vegetables, or even a warm grain salad.
- Can leftovers be stored? Absolutely!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
